Switzerland defeated Colombia in a penalty shootout in Vancouver on Tuesday to reach the quarter-finals of the World Cup. They go on to face title holders Argentina, who survived an almighty scare against Egypt earlier in the day.Switzerland will now face Argentina in the last eight after prevailing 4-3 on penalties against the Colombians after the match finished 0-0 after extra time.The Swiss had not reached the quarter-finals of a World Cup since hosting the tournament in 1954. And they were shorthanded Tuesday without breakout star Johan Manzambi, who was injured in training on Monday.
